Podcasts have become a popular form of entertainment and information in today's digital age. From true crime to self-help, there seems to be a podcast for everyone. In order to keep up with the ever-evolving landscape of podcasting, hosts often rely on listener surveys to gather feedback and improve their shows. However, when it comes to sharing survey results, it is crucial to approach the process with etiquette and courtesy. **Why Etiquette Matters** Etiquette and courtesy may seem like old-fashioned concepts, but they play a vital role in the realm of podcasting. When sharing survey results with hosts, producers, or other listeners, it's important to be mindful of your tone and language. Constructive criticism is valuable, but it should be delivered in a respectful manner. Remember that behind every podcast is a team of dedicated individuals who pour their time and effort into creating content for their audience. **Tips for Providing Feedback** When sharing survey results with podcast hosts, consider the following tips to ensure your feedback is received positively: 1. Be specific: Instead of vague comments like "I didn't like it," provide specific examples or suggestions for improvement. 2. Be respectful: Critique the content, not the person. Remember that podcast hosts are human too and may be sensitive to harsh criticism. 3. Be constructive: Offer actionable insights that can help the host enhance their content. Whether it's audio quality, pacing, or episode topics, provide suggestions that can lead to tangible improvements. **Expressing Gratitude** Whether you're a podcast host receiving survey results or a listener providing feedback, expressing gratitude is key. Remember that the feedback you receive is a gift that can help you grow and evolve as a content creator. Take the time to thank survey participants for their time and insights, and demonstrate that their feedback is valued. **In conclusion, maintaining etiquette and courtesy when sharing podcast survey results is essential for creating a positive and constructive feedback loop. By approaching feedback with respect and gratitude, podcast creators can leverage survey results to enhance the quality of their content and cultivate a loyal listener base. Remember, behind every podcast statistic is a listener who took the time to share their thoughts - treat their feedback with care and consideration.**
